## Formula sandbox tuning

User-supplied formulas in Gridmoor execute inside a restricted interpreter with hard ceilings on time, memory, and call depth. Reviewers should confirm any change to these ceilings is justified in the PR description, since raising them widens the abuse surface. Defaults were chosen from production traces. The current limits are as follows.

limits module of tafog-fawip:
WEIGHTS = {
    "julix": 57,
    "lamys": 992,
    "kasvan": 209,
    "quenok": 750,
    "alddor": 259,
    "oliath": 1009,
    "wenix": 815,
}

## Support

If `stringsift` blows up mid-extraction, it's usually a malformed placeholder in one of the locale files — check the last file it logged before dying. Re-run with `--lenient` to skip the bad entry and keep going. If the output catalog looks truncated or keys vanish, don't guess; ping the localization tooling crew right away.

escalation mailbox, bafog-fafog: ulador@paliqlabs.internal

**PR: cap Fennick sidecar aggregation window and raise drop alerts**

The Fennick metrics-aggregation sidecar was coalescing samples over an unbounded window, causing stale gauges under load. This change caps the window, adds a hard flush on shutdown, and emits a drop counter support can watch.

No customer-facing config changes. Support: if graphs lag after rollout, check the new drop counter first.

Defaults are overridable. The shipped tuning constants are:

tuning table, yajog-yahof:
BUDGETS = {
    "lamvan": 303,
    "wenox": 460,
    "fenvan": 525,
}